The notorious Bacon Brothers : inside gang warfare on Vancouver streets

Summary: "Infamous and seemingly untouchable, the Bacon Brothers publicly lived the successful gangster lifestyle to a tee, with flashy cars, jewelry and a serious reputation for violence. What was unusual was their comfortable, middle-class upbringing and stable family life-- rather than being left with no option but crime, they seemed to hae made a conscious decision to step outside the law. Unfortunately for them, nothing in the criminal underworld is permanent, and shifting alliances, rivalries and police work eventually caught up with each of them."--P. [4] of cover.

    A searing look at one of Canada's most dangerous gangs

    Gang violence is nothing new to Vancouver, but the brutality of the Bacon Brothers—Jonathan, Jarrod, and Jamie—has become legendary. The Notorious Bacon Brothers follows the chaotic rise of these three gangland figures to the pinnacle of Vancouver's lucrative drug trade. Chronicling not only the Bacon Brothers themselves, but also the gangs they infiltrated on their way to the top, and the catastrophic wave of violence they brought to the streets of Vancouver, the book explores how the bothers' adeptness at making and breaking allegiances and propensity for violence is now being replicated by gangs across Canada.

    With one Bacon brother dead and the other two behind bars, a power vacuum has developed for control of the drug trade in the Greater Vancouver area. The result has been full on war among the Hells Angels, Red Scorpions, UN Gang, and Independent Soldiers, as they fight to take the position once occupied by the Bacon Brothers—a lasting legacy to their place in Canada's gang history.
